Professor Asenov is a fellow of the Royal Academy of Scotland, an IEEE Fellow and a member of the IEEE Electron Device Society Technology Computer-Aided Design Committee and of the BP Fellowship Committee. He is a co-author of European Nanoelectronics Advisory Council (ENIAC) Strategic Research Agenda (SRA) and acted on behave of EC as and reviewer for more than 15 EC projects and as an evaluator of several FP5, FP6 and FP7 calls. He has been a general chair, co-chair and TPC chair for many international conferences.
RESEARCH INTERESTS
Leader of the Device Modeling Group. Research includes
(i) development of advanced drift diffusion, Monte Carlo and quantum transport simulations tools focused on atomic scale CMOS statistical variability and reliability;
(ii) statistical compact model extraction;
(iii) statistical circuit simulations;
(iv) development of nano-bio simulation tools.
